French dip egg rolls

What you'll need:

makes 7-8 egg rolls

  • 1lb of shaved rib-eye steak

  • 1 yellow onion (sliced)

  • au jus packet

  • 1 tsp of balsalmic vinegar

  • swiss cheese (shredded)

  • chives for garnish

  • horseraddish cream

  • salt & pepper

  • vegetable oil


Directions:

  1. To a skillet on medium heat add a tbsp of butter, once melted add in the onions and a pinch of salt and balsamic vinegar. Saute for about 10mins stirring occasionly .

  2. Prepare the au jus according to directions on the packet.

  3. To a skillet add 1 tbsp of avocado oil on medium high heat, once heated add the ribeye and season with salt & pepper. and cook to your liking.

  4. Add water to the edges of you egg roll wrappers. Add swiss cheese, a nice heaping of the meat, and sauteed onions. Fold the bottom corner over the filling and fold over the left and right corners in and roll up. Seal with more water if needed.

  5. Fry in oil until golden brown. Top with horseradish cream and top with chives. Serve with au jus and more horsehadish cream for dipping. ENJOY!
